Do you feel like your child’s playroom is constantly cluttered and disorganized? If so, you’re not alone. Keeping a child’s play area tidy can be a challenge, but with the right tips and tricks, it can be a breeze. Here are five of the best ways to organize your kid’s play areas.

1. Use Storage Bins

Storage bins are a great way to organize toys, art supplies, and other items in your child’s play area. Consider using clear plastic bins so your child can easily see what’s inside. Label each bin with a picture or a word to help your child learn where things belong.

2. Utilize Wall Space

Wall space can be a great place to hang storage solutions for your child’s play area. Install a pegboard or a bookshelf to keep toys off the floor and within reach.

3. Create Zones

Divide the play area into different zones, such as a reading corner, a craft area, and a toy area. This will help your child understand where things belong and make it easier for them to clean up.

4. Rotate Toys

Consider rotating your child’s toys on a regular basis. This will keep their play area fresh and exciting while also preventing clutter from accumulating.

5. Get Your Child Involved

Teach your child the importance of keeping their play area organized and involve them in the process. Encourage them to help with cleaning up and have them put away their toys when they’re finished playing.

By implementing these tips, you can make your child’s play area a tidy and organized space that both you and your child can enjoy.
